Benefits of Trenchless Pipe and Sewer Repair
When you've got backed-up drains and clogged up major sewer lines, it can ruin your building and leave it with a foul smell. Worst of all, it is a major health hazard. Fortunately, trenchless pipelining can come to your rescue as this sewer fixing method is non-invasive as well as highly efficient. Unlike the god old days where plumbings had to dig large openings to find the issue, they now leverage technology.
Today's licensed plumbing professionals dig tiny openings on the ground for a camera assessment to locate the sewer line problems. After, they place a thin epoxy-reliner, which is cured in position, leaving a brand-new pipe within the old pipe. Picking the appropriate repair service method is key for an effective drain repair task. Take a look at the benefits of trenchless sewage system pipelining below:

Decreases Substantial Damage to Property


Standard sewer repair service plumbing techniques needed substantial digs that ruined garages, yards, cellar flooring, and perhaps even wall surfaces. That's a lot of civilian casualties, which you have to take care of later. Nonetheless, the trenchless technique only digs a small hole, leaving your residential or commercial property intact.

Supplies Better Worth for Cash


Though trenchless repair services will certainly cost you, it does conserve you cash over time. Keep in mind, without damage to building; you don't need to pay for reconstruction. Besides, the benefit and comfort this offers your household is invaluable. Above all, this strategy utilizes much less crewmen, so expect lower labor costs.

Assures Long Lasting Outcomes


Since the epoxy liner works as a new pipe, you can depend on long life. These advanced reliners don't rust, to make sure that's additionally far better resilience. When set up in your house, this brand-new treated pipeline might last for around 50 years, providing you total comfort.

Why Trenchless Pipe Lining Is The Best Sewer Line Solution


Sewer pipes cannot last forever. Pipes made of materials like cast iron, galvanized steel, and clay will develop a buildup of corrosion over time, which often leads to cracks.



Tree roots that grow through such cracks in search of water are likely to cause drain buildups, which can be a nightmare.



In the past, digging up the damaged pipe and replacing it with a new one was the only option. Apart from requiring a significant amount of time, this process often led to the destruction of lawns and floors.


The pipelining process explained


The inside of a sewer line needs cleaning and repair if it cracks due to corrosion and tree root intrusion. Using mechanical cutters to clean removes the buildup of roots and corrosion, ensuring cured-in-place-pipe (CIPP), an epoxy liner, adheres to the damaged pipe.



After the pipe is clean, the epoxy saturates a felt liner cut on the outside so that the two-part epoxy adheres to the tube’s inner side. The adhesion makes it impossible for water to flow between the damaged host pipe and liner.


Stops Leaks and Prevents Root Intrusion


Nu Flow molds to the host pipe’s diameter, creating a seamless pipe within and sealing every gap, which eliminates the possibility of future root intrusion.



Water usually seeps out below properties and into landscapes or underground structures whenever sewer lines have separations, cracks, or root intrusions.



This uncontrolled seepage is sure to compromise the drainage system, and this will most likely result in sinkholes and structural issues. Fortunately, a trenchless sewer repair is quite effective when it comes to eliminating this problem.


Increased Flow


Cured-in-place-pipes increase flow because the cured pipes are smoother than those made of every other material, clay, cast iron, and concrete included.



Calcification deposits do not adhere to the epoxy-lined surface of the pipe, which translates to unimpeded flow as well as significant reduction of future blockage from regular use.
